Job Summary
Position is responsible for providing professional nursing care to individuals including the intravenous or injection administration of biologics or other specialty pharmaceutical products and promotes patient health by completing health reviews prior to treatment, reviews patient files and collaborates with physicians and multidisciplinary team members as required, with the end goal of providing medical therapies or self- administration teaching to patients in an ambulatory setting.
The nurse uses critical thinking, therapeutic communication and clinical decision making skills to assess, plan, implement, educate and evaluate the patients' health situation throughout their treatment therapy.
• Starting Wage at $45.43/Hour Plus Premiums and Incentives!*
Specific Responsibilities
Assessing the health status of patients using a pre-screening process that covers contraindications, objective and subjective data, to determine eligibility in receiving medical therapies.
Insertion of peripheral intravenous or establishing access via central lines using sterile technique and best practices from the standards and practices of the college.
Studying patient files and prior post-administration records to understand patient's history.
Handling and reconstituting biologic or oncology medication as per manufacturer and Heath Canada guidelines.
Following provincial College of Nurses standards and guidelines on medication administration.
Identifying patient care requirements; educating and providing counseling.
Promoting patient independence; answering questions and teaching patients to understand their condition and medication.
Documenting patient care services and managing records in accordance with INVIVA policies.
Following INVIVA and nursing philosophies and standards of care.
Following patient specific medical directives for administration and treatment of adverse events.
Reporting adverse events in accordance with manufacturer specific requirements, Health Canada and INVIVA policy.
Providing medical therapy monitoring and post administration observation and assessment.
Maintaining knowledge of medical therapies as per Health Canada's Product Monograph.
Maintaining knowledge of INVIVA policies and procedures.
Participating with drug and clinic audits upon request.
Following drug accountability requirements as per INVIVA policy and standard operating procedure.
Actively participates in training and mentoring of new clinic staff.
Completing training as required by INVIVA on: products and services, policies, technology, quality assurance and communications.
Maintaining quality, safety and infection control standards to ensure safe nursing practice
